MONEYVAL: Fifth Round Evaluation Report on Lithuania
On 8 February 2019, MONEYVAL published its fifth round evaluation report on Lithuania. As regards national risk assessment, Lithuania faces a number of ML threats, mainly from corruption, the shadow economy, organised crime, and the widespread use of cash. Concrete results are apparent in reducing the shadow economy, but further efforts are needed, especially in the investigation and prosecution of ML and AML/CFT supervision.

MONEYVAL: Fifth Round Evaluation Report on the Czech Republic
On 11 February 2019, MONEYVAL published its fifth round evaluation report on the Czech Republic. The report acknowledges the accuracy of the risk assessments by Czech authorities. Correspondingly, ML occurs mostly in conjunction with tax crimes, fraud, corruption, phishing, and subvention fraud. The probability of FT occurring remains low.

GRECO: Belarus Non-Compliant with CoE Anti-Corruption Standards
In an unprecedented move on 19 March 2019, GRECO publicly proclaimed in a Declaration that Belarus does not comply with the anti-corruption standards of the CoE.

GRECO: Fifth Round Evaluation Report on The Netherlands
On 22 February 2019, GRECO published its fifth round evaluation report on The Netherlands, which calls upon the Dutch authorities to further intensify corruption prevention measures, both in top executive functions and vis-à-vis members of law enforcement agencies.

GRECO: Fifth Round Evaluation Report on Malta
On 3 April 2019, GRECO published its fifth round evaluation report on Malta. The focus of this evaluation round is on preventing corruption and promoting integrity in central governments (top executive functions) and law enforcement agencies. The evaluation focuses particularly on issues, such as conflicts of interest, the declaration of assets, and accountability mechanisms.
